Looks like a decent faucet. One of the reviews mentions it uses Moen parts (or compatible parts).

I think this product would be great for a rental home or apartment, to replace builder grade. Not so much for my forever home.

I plan on living in my home until I die or cannot anymore. I am going to go with a product from a company I know and one I know will be around for years to come. That is why I have a Delta faucet. Yes, it cost around $150 in 2009, but it still looks great and performs as it should to this day. I had an issue with my Delta faucet (it dripped). Called Delta, provided the model name, they shipped me the replacement part with detailed instructions for free. Lifetime warranties are great. After taking it apart, I realized that it was something that just needed to be tightened (but I replaced the part anyway).
